Understanding the Welding Amp Meter

The welding amp meter measures the current flowing through the welding circuit in amperes (amps). Accurate readings help welders maintain consistent heat, which is crucial for different materials and welding techniques. Most amp meters are connected in series with the welding circuit, providing real-time data during operation.

Steps to Use a Welding Amp Meter

  • Connect the Amp Meter: Attach the meter’s leads in series with the welding circuit, ensuring secure and correct connections.
  • Set Your Welding Parameters: Choose the appropriate welding mode and material settings on your machine.
  • Start Welding: Begin welding while observing the amp meter reading.
  • Adjust the Current: Use your machine’s controls to increase or decrease the amperage based on the meter readings and desired weld quality.
  • Monitor Consistency: Keep an eye on the amp meter throughout the process to maintain steady current flow.

Tips for Fine-Tuning Your Settings

To achieve the best welds, consider the following tips:

  • Start with Manufacturer Recommendations: Use the suggested amperage range for your material and welding process.
  • Make Small Adjustments: Fine-tune the current gradually to avoid overheating or weak welds.
  • Observe the Weld Pool: A stable, smooth weld pool indicates proper current; excessive spatter or weak welds suggest the need for adjustment.
  • Practice Consistency: Regularly check the amp meter during welding to maintain steady current flow.
